Parent Support Session 2

Yesterday we had our second session with parents of our students in Year 3.    We started today by looking at this Technology Blog and exploring the range of different stories of learning showcased within it.  In particular, we focussed on recent ‘green screen’ movie making in Year 4 history, the use of teacher created iBooks in History and the use of 3D printing and blogging in English.

The practical part of today was to look at ‘Explain Everything’  as a means of making thinking visible.  We talked about the benefits of using technology in this way which includes:

  • students making their thinking visible
  • students working with each other to confirm understanding
  • enabling the teacher to provide feedback and direction to the whole class.
  • enabling the teacher to direct the next teachable moment
  • students having to articulate their understanding
